Internal Memo — Revised Commission Scheme

To all sales leads: effective next quarter, Thornley Instruments moves to a tiered commission model. Base rate drops to 3%, with accelerators at 110% and 125% of target. Renewals on the Axion line count at half weight. Please hold questions until the regional call. The rationale is set out in the confidential note below.

confidential, bahap-bajog: Zorethix Works is in early talks to buy Kelethox Foods for about $30.7 million. The Ralvan launch date is September 19, and nothing goes to the press before then.

Step 3 — Verify dependency pins. The Corvetta build refuses floating versions; every package in the lockfile must resolve to an exact pin, and reviewers should reject any range specifier. Run the pin audit locally before approving. The audit tool authenticates to our internal mirror, so your env file must contain the following line.

vault entry, kafog-yahop: COURIER_KEY8=0faa53ae

Subject: DR Drill — SproutCycle Scheduler, Friday Window

Hi plugin authors,

This Friday we're running a disaster-recovery drill on the SproutCycle watering scheduler. Your plugins will see a brief API outage while we fail over to the Brindle region replica. No action needed unless your plugin caches schedules locally. To restore the staging vault yourselves during the drill, use the recovery passphrase below.

vault phrase of bagaf-kajeg = jorath-feniel-briir-siliel-ralix

Handover from Ilse to whoever picks up font work on Penwright: all third-party fonts are vendored under assets/fonts with their license files beside them — never pull fonts from a CDN at build time, as our legal review requires pinned, auditable copies. Each addition needs a license check and a checksum entry. The full vendoring procedure is written up here.

runbook for taduf-kawef: https://confluence.qorvelsys.internal/projects/display/display/pages

## Account Recovery — Trailnote Offline Mode

When a surveyor's Trailnote app has been offline for 30+ days, their local credentials expire and sync refuses to resume. Don't make them wipe the device — all their unsynced field data lives there! Instead, open the support console, pick "Offline Reinstate," and enter their handle. The console will ask for the support team's shared recovery passphrase before issuing a reinstatement token. Use the one below.

unlock words, bagaf-fajeg: zorael-kelax-fraath-quenix-eliok-sileth-aldmir-wenir-druiel